  • What is Cavaillon known for?

    Cavaillon is known for its succulent melons, lively Provençal markets, and Roman heritage sites. Its blend of rural traditions and historic monuments draws travelers looking for a locally rooted experience.

  • What are the best hidden gems to explore in Cavaillon?

    Seek out small artisan workshops tucked along quiet streets or visit the lesser-known chapels around the old city. The Jewish Synagogue and its unique ritual bath are also thought-provoking, reflecting Cavaillon’s layered history.

  • What are the best foods to try in Cavaillon?

    Try Cavaillon melon, artisanal goat cheese, and olive-based spreads, which are frequently suggested in cafes and markets. Savory tarts, tapenade, and Provençal honey are also local favorites.

  • What are the most popular events or festivals in Cavaillon?

    The Melon Festival celebrates local produce in summer, and regional arts fairs or cultural events often fill the calendar during late spring and autumn. Traditional markets bring music, crafts, and local foods into the heart of the city.
